What does the NARIC stand for?
NARIC stands for National Academic Recognition Information Centres, a network of national bodies in Europe that provide information and advice on the recognition of foreign academic qualifications, working with the European Network of Information Centres (ENIC) to facilitate academic mobility and consistent assessment of international degrees. How much does a NARIC certificate cost?
For the Visas and Nationality (English proficiency) service, the fee is £140 plus VAT. For either of the PhD verification services, including PhD verification with English proficiency, the fee is £210 plus VAT. These fees cover the assessment and, where relevant, verification of the qualification.What documents do I need for NARIC?

ECCTIS, previously known as UK NARIC, operates on behalf of the UK Home Office to assist visa applicants in verifying their qualifications. It previously offered the Visa & Nationality Service, which has now been phased out from 1 May 2025.How long is UK NARIC valid for?
How long is a UK NARIC certificate valid? A UK NARIC (Ecctis) certificate does not expire. However, some institutions or visa processes may require a recent issue date, typically within 1–2 years.Are US degrees recognized in the UK?
